Whether you’re hauling gear on a multi-purpose utility trailer, towing an RV to a campsite, or launching a boat on a waterfront ramp, the trailer’s electrical system must stay dry and reliable. Outdoor trailers face rain, mud, salt spray, and constant vibration – all of which can cause ordinary wiring to short out or corrode.
In these challenging conditions, a waterproof wire harness is crucial for protecting lights, brakes, and signals. High-quality harnesses use durable, corrosion-resistant copper conductors and rugged weatherproof insulation. They are designed to withstand rain, snow, road debris, and extreme temperatures, ensuring the trailer’s electrical circuits remain intact.

Key Features of Reliable Trailer Harnesses
An excellent trailer wiring harness combines multiple protective features. In practice, look for:
- Durable, Corrosion-Resistant Materials: Conductors should be made of high-grade copper (often tin-plated), and the jacket should be made of weatherproof plastics (e.g., PVC, XLPE). Such materials resist rust and cracking, ensuring the wiring remains strong even in harsh outdoor conditions.
- Weatherproof, Sealed Design: The harness should prevent the entry of moisture and dust. Quality harnesses use IP-rated, sealed connectors or over-molded plugs (IP67 or higher). Injection-molded connector housings and rubber grommets block rain and road spray from reaching bare wires. This keeps circuits from shorting out or corroding.
- Secure, Locking Connectors: Pins and sockets that lock together (with screws, clamps, or snap-fit features) ensure stable, continuous contact, even under vibration. Good designs utilize strain reliefs and firmly crimped terminals to prevent connections from shaking loose during trailer movement.
- UV-Stable, Flame-Retardant Insulation: Harness jackets often include UV inhibitors to protect exposed trailers from sun damage. Low-smoke, halogen-free compounds are commonly used in high-quality harnesses to minimize toxic fumes in the event of damage. Overall, robust insulation prolongs lifespan in sunlight and extreme heat.
- Versatile, Plug-and-Play Compatibility: A reliable harness is made to match your trailer and tow vehicle. Whether it’s a simple 4-pin flat for a utility trailer or a 7-pin RV-style connector, the harness should plug right into the existing wiring without custom splicing. Many harnesses even include extra circuits (such as reverse lights, brake controllers, and auxiliary power) for specialty trailers.
Typical Challenges and Harnessing Solutions
Outdoor trailers face several environmental challenges. The table below summarizes how modern harnesses address each one:
| Environmental Challenge | Harness Design Feature |
|---|---|
| Water and moisture intrusion | IP-rated sealed connectors (often IP67+) (e.g. injection-molded housings with o-rings) to keep rain and splashes out. |
| UV/Sunlight exposure | UV-resistant cable jackets and insulations (with UV blockers or additives) to prevent cracking and degradation from sun. |
| Corrosive elements (salt, chemicals) | Tin-plated (marine-grade) copper conductors and corrosion-resistant terminals. Sealed junctions prevent salt spray from entering. |
| Vibration and abrasion | Reinforced sheathing (braided or spiral wrap) and strain reliefs. Locking connector mechanisms stop pins from working loose under road shock. |
This coordinated design ensures that trailers remain roadworthy even after repeated exposure to wet conditions or rough use. For example, a waterproof 7-pin RV-style plug may utilize a detachable compression nut and rubber gasket to prevent moisture from entering. Together with tinned wiring and heavy-duty insulation, the harness ensures that all trailer lighting and brakes remain functional in rain or off-road conditions.

Multi-pin trailer connectors (like the 13-pin plug shown above) illustrate how sealed designs work. These plugs are often molded to fit precisely, with rubber grommets covering each pin cluster. Wires enter through a sealed gland or compression fitting, so no water seeps in. High-quality harnesses typically include such advanced connectors. Many also feature UV-blocking cable jackets and flame-retardant insulation to guard against the sun and heat. In short, every part of the harness – from the wire itself to the outer jacketing to the connectors – is chosen for rugged outdoor service.
Connector Types for Different Trailers
It helps to match the harness to your trailer’s connector type. Small utility trailers typically use a 4-way flat plug (simple for tail, stop, and turn signals), while RVs and large campers use a 7-way round or blade plug. Boat trailers in saltwater climates often use sealed 6-pin or 7-pin round connectors with IP67–IP68 ratings and tinned wiring to resist corrosion. Horse and heavy-duty trailers may also use 6-pin round or heavy-gauge 7-pin plugs. No matter the type, the key is the waterproofing features described above. Many off-the-shelf kits now come with plug-and-play capabilities for standard connectors, making installation fast while ensuring the gear remains protected in all weather conditions.
